#df4afd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#df4afd is composed of 87.5% red, 29%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.9% cyan, 70.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 289.9 degrees, a saturation of 97.8% and a lightness of 64.1%. #df4afd color hex could be obtained by blending #ff94ff with #bf00fb.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

#df4afd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#df4afd has RGB values of R:223, G:74, B:253 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0.71,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 14633725.
